An example of sag on a vehicle's rear axle under a heavy load

Whether you're hauling heavy loads in your bed or cargo area or you're towing a trailer, you will often see the rear of your vehicle sag while the front end rises. In these cases, the rear axle is handling not only the weight of the cargo, but also more of the vehicle's weight. Because less weight is on the front axle, the front tires are making less contact with the road. Overall handling - traction, steering, and braking - is negatively affected. But the resistance from Timbren's Suspension Enhancement System works with your factory suspension to keep your vehicle level and improve your driving experience.


Diagram of the Timbren spring installed

The Timbren system comes with custom-fit brackets that are bolted onto each frame rail above the rear axle. Hollow rubber springs are bolted to the bottom of the bracket and hang down to where the bottom of the spring sits, 1" above the axle. The inch of clearance allows the existing factory suspension to operate normally under light loads and standard terrain, ensuring the smooth, comfortable ride that you are used to.


Animation of a standard Timbren rubber spring

Timbren Suspension Enhancement Systems are designed to work progressively. When the hollow rubber springs are compressed, the convoluted design causes them to quickly collapse along the folds. Once the folds are compacted, the stacked barrel shape increases resistance, stiffening the suspension and keeping your vehicle level.


Timbren suspension system works to prevent body roll

Each hollow rubber spring works independently to support the driver's side or passenger's side of your vehicle. This is helpful when you swerve or make sharp turns. Each spring is activated when it is needed, so body roll is greatly reduced. The independent action also works well when you are hauling off-center loads.


An example of a trailers swaying

Because the vehicle handles better with the springs, less turbulence will be passed along to the trailer, and this helps to keep the trailer in line. Your driving comfort is further enhanced if the trailer does begin to sway (from a gust of wind or a passing semi), because the movement from the trailer is not transferred to your vehicle. This also works to make the sway subside more quickly.


An empty truck on a bumpy road without Timbren

Another great feature of the rubber construction is that the springs absorb most of the road shock, creating a smoother, more stable ride overall. Wear and tear on the factory suspension is also lessened because the rubber springs work to prevent bottoming out on rough roads.


Timbren Suspension Enhancement Compared to the Competition

Timbren's Suspension Enhancement Systems are much easier to install than air springs - there are no air hoses to run, no compressors or gauges to hook up, and no manual adjustments to make. The rubber construction makes Timbren's springs more elastic than similar products constructed of microcellular urethane. And more elasticity allows for a more comfortable ride because the rubber has more travel.

See what our Experts say about this Timbren Vehicle Suspension

  • Comparing Timbren Rear Suspension Enhancement System for 2016 Ram 3500 Towing 5th Wheel
    I understand the confusion based on the difference in capacity. The key is the difference in design. The Timbren Rear Suspension Enhancement System # T94VR is designated as a Severe Service kit so the springs are always engaged. Although the capacity is slightly lower at 8,000 lbs, the design is intended for a constant heavy load like a salt spreader or in-bed camper. Based on the frequency of your towing you want the Timbren Rear Suspension Enhancement System # TDR3500CA. These have...

  • What is the Difference Between my Payload/Cargo Capacity and Towing Capacity
    There seems to be a bit of confusion here, which I'll try to clear up. There are 3 main capacities related to the weight your vehicle can handle that you generally want to know; your payload (cargo) capacity and towing capacity are going to be two different ratings, and your truck will also have a combined weight rating (GCWR) which is the maximum combined weight of the truck, payload (cargo) and trailer. From what I was able to find with my research, the 2012 Ram 2500 with the 6.7L Diesel...

  • Does the Pin Weight of a 5th Wheel Trailer Count Towards the Payload Capacity
    You're correct that the pin weight of your trailer is going to take away from the payload capacity, since that weight is going to be over or slightly forward of the rear axle of your truck and also correct that it is typically around 18- 20% of the GVWR of the trailer. The payload also gives you 150-lbs that is not considered (the average male driver) so it's technically 150-lbs more than what it says. If you have a 10000-lb trailer, the tongue weight should be around 1800-2000-lbs (you...
